Graphics Processor (GPU)

This is your non-negotiable starting point. For under $1500, target an NVIDIA RTX 4050 or 4060, or an AMD Radeon equivalent. This tier delivers excellent 1080p performance with high settings and enables features like DLSS for smoother frame rates. Avoid integrated graphics or older-generation dedicated GPUs for serious gaming.

Central Processing Unit (CPU)

Look for a modern, multi-core processor to prevent bottlenecking your GPU. AMD Ryzen 7 series or Intel Core i5/i7 CPUs from the 12th generation onward are ideal. High boost clock speeds (over 4.0GHz) are crucial for gaming, while core count (8 cores/16 threads is great) benefits streaming and multitasking.

Display Quality

A fast refresh rate (144Hz or higher) is essential for smooth, tear-free gameplay, making action and competitive titles feel responsive. Pair this with good color coverage (sRGB) and a resolution that matches your GPU; Full HD (1920×1080) is the standard for this budget, offering the best balance of performance and visual fidelity.

Thermal Design and Build

Robust cooling is what separates a good laptop from a throttled, noisy one. Look for mentions of multi-heatpipe systems, dual or triple fans, and performance modes. A chassis built from aluminum or rigid plastic will better withstand heat and travel, ensuring longevity over flimsy, all-plastic constructions.

Gaming Laptop FAQ

Is 16GB of RAM enough for gaming in 2025?

For the vast majority of games, 16GB of DDR4 or DDR5 RAM is still the sweet spot. It allows for smooth gameplay while having background applications like Discord or a browser open. Consider 32GB only if you simultaneously run heavy creative software or plan to keep the laptop for many years.

How important is an SSD for gaming?

Critically important. An NVMe SSD drastically reduces game load times, level transitions, and system boot-up compared to a traditional hard drive. A 512GB SSD is the practical minimum, but 1TB is highly recommended to accommodate modern game file sizes without constant management.

Can I upgrade the RAM and storage later?

It depends entirely on the model. Many gaming laptops offer user-accessible slots for adding more RAM or a second SSD, but some solder components to the motherboard. Always check the manufacturer's specifications or teardown reviews for upgradeability before purchasing if future expansion is a priority.

Are gaming laptops good for tasks other than gaming?

Absolutely. The powerful CPUs and GPUs that drive games are equally adept at video editing, 3D rendering, and other creative workloads. Their high-refresh-rate displays also make for a smooth general computing experience, though they often sacrifice some battery life compared to ultraportables.
